I took a short walk along the beach below the Prairie du Sac Dam. I heard a song that I didn't recognize and thought it might be an odd singing Oriole or Robin, so when a first year male Summer Tanager came into view and began singing it was a nice surprise. The bird probably a little over half red with still quite a bit of blotchy green coloration. It had a larger paler bill than a Scarlet Tanager and did not have black wings. I was unable to get any photos but I did get a couple sound recordings while is sang overhead. It was located south of the parking lot where the sandy beach ends and turns into a trail up into the oak forest. Just a few steps into the woods is where the tanager was singing to the west of the trail.
